Information
Elysso Hotel is officially classified as a 2 star hotel, offering the highest quality of comfort and relaxation.
The hotel was built in 1985 and renovated all the rooms in 2008.

Overall, I would recommend staying here - for the price I paid anyway (£25 a night).
I think the hotel is good value for money and the staff are great, but there are areas that prevent me giving 5*. Firstly, the pool wasn't open - it only opens over summer - but it was 28 degrees this week, so definitely warm enough. Secondly, the air con has an odd system where you need to phone reception every time you want it turned on. Lastly, the breakfast, although free, is basic and the same thing everyday.
There are plenty of positives though. Staff are great. Location is fine, a 20 min walk to the main beach and a 10 min walk from Lidl. The room itself was also decent and clean. There is also a great sandwich shop nearby called Marantona - definitely pay it a visit.

Area Information
Larnaca, situated on the southern coast of Cyprus, is a charming coastal city renowned for its beautiful beaches, rich history, and vibrant culture. Nestled beside the azure waters of the Mediterranean Sea, Larnaca offers visitors a plethora of attractions and activities to enjoy.
The city boasts a picturesque promenade lined with palm trees, perfect for leisurely strolls and enjoying breathtaking sunsets. Visitors can explore the historic streets of Larnaca's Old Town, where ancient churches and mosques stand alongside quaint cafes and traditional tavernas.
Larnaca is also home to several notable landmarks, including the stunning Hala Sultan Tekke mosque and the fascinating Larnaca Salt Lake, a haven for migratory birds. For those seeking relaxation, the city's pristine beaches, such as Finikoudes Beach and Mackenzie Beach, offer golden sands and crystal-clear waters ideal for swimming and sunbathing.
Additionally, Larnaca offers a vibrant culinary scene, with an array of restaurants serving delicious Cypriot cuisine and fresh seafood delicacies.
Whether you're interested in history, culture, or simply soaking up the Mediterranean sun, Larnaca has something for everyone, making it an ideal destination for your next getaway.
Places of Interest
-
Finikoudes Beach - A popular sandy beach lined with palm trees, perfect for swimming and sunbathing.
-
Larnaca Salt Lake - A unique natural phenomenon and a haven for migratory birds, especially flamingos.
-
Hala Sultan Tekke - A stunning mosque located on the shores of Larnaca Salt Lake, with beautiful architecture and serene surroundings.
-
Larnaca Castle - An ancient fortress dating back to the Byzantine era, offering panoramic views of the city and the sea.
-
St. Lazarus Church - A beautiful Byzantine church housing the tomb of Saint Lazarus, a significant religious site.
-
Larnaca Marina - A picturesque harbor lined with cafes, restaurants, and shops, ideal for leisurely walks and boat watching.
-
Pierides Museum - A museum showcasing the rich history and archaeology of Cyprus, with a collection of artifacts dating back thousands of years.
